Investar Bank to build new branch at Commerce Centre in Prairieville

In a deal that closed this afternoon, Baton Rouge-based Investar Bank purchased a 0.8-acre lot at Commerce Centre––a commercial park in Prairieville located on the southwest corner of Airline Highway and Commerce Centre Drive, across from La. 42––for $550,000. The bank intends to immediately begin construction on a full-service branch at the site, says Chris Pike of Mike Falgoust & Associates, who represented Investar in the deal. It hopes to complete the new branch by the end of the year, Pike says, adding Investar is still exploring options for an existing branch on La. 42. "Once the new one is built they will decide what to do with that branch," he says in an email, "but it's likely that [we] will put it on the market for sale." Investar, which recently filed paperwork for its initial public offering of stock, is also building a branch on Highland Road near Alexander's Highland Market. The seller in the deal completed today was Commerce Centre 42 Development LLC, which in March purchased the final 15 available lots at Commerce Centre—covering a little under 16 acres—for $3.48 million. Grey Hammett and Scot Guidry, who are also with Mike Falgoust & Associates, represented Commerce Centre 42 Development in the deal.
